>> The central problem is that i can't start the mysql daemon (mysqld_safe
>> --user=mysql)
>> I has created the cluster with mysql_install_db ok, ... at the time tha
>> i run the daemon it exit with no information and no backround process.
>
> I just set up mysql for the first time last weekend, and I had trouble
> with this too.  mysql's error log is /var/mysql/*.err.
>
> make sure that everything under /var/mysql is owned by the mysql user.
> that was the main problem I had.
